 Stonávka  (Polish: Stonawka ) is a 33 kilometres (21 mi)-long river in the Karviná District, Moravian-Silesian Region, Czech Republic, in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ia.

Map of Ston%C3%A1vka, Czechia

It is a left tributary of the Olza River, which it enters in Karviná. It flows through Albrechtice and Stonava before entering Karviná. The Těrlicko Dam is located on this river.

The name is of the river means a murmuring river.
